Dennis and Ivy share some sweets between them in the ratio 7:4 Dennis got 42 sweets. How many does ivy get
MrRa [10]

Answer:

Ivy = 24

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Dennis : Ivy = 7 : 4

Required

Determine the amount of sweet Ivy gets when Dennis = 42

We have:

Dennis : Ivy = 7 : 4 and

Dennis = 42

Substitute 42 for Dennis in Dennis : Ivy = 7 : 4

42 : Ivy = 7 : 4

Convert to fraction

\frac{42}{Ivy} = \frac{7}{4}

Cross Multiply:

Ivy * 7 = 42 * 4

Divide through by 7

\frac{Ivy * 7}{7} = \frac{42 * 4}{7}

Ivy = \frac{42 * 4}{7}

Ivy = 6* 4

Ivy = 24
